What to Expect:
The Mail Clerk is responsible for receiving, sorting, scanning, and routing incoming mail and documents to the appropriate departments in a timely manner. This position handles confidential and protected information and must maintain strict compliance with HIPAA, company confidential standards, and records management procedures. The role also provides general administrative support to maintain office operations
Key Responsibilities
Mail Processing
Receive, sort, open, and organize incoming mail from multiple internal and external sources. Determine the appropriate department for each document and route accordingly.
Document Management
Scan documents accurately and electronically distribute them to the appropriate department. Maintain document quality and ensure timely processing. Identify opportunities to improve mail routing efficiency and perform other duties as assigned.
Compliance and Confidentiality
Handle confidential and protected information in accordance with HIPAA and Matrix policies. Protect sensitive employee, provider, and business information. Maintain an organized workspace
Administrative Support
Assist with copying, filing, printing, and other administrative duties.
Equipment
Operate scanners, copiers, postage equipment, and other office machines safety and efficiently
